Job Description

Provide ServiceNow development and support for governance capabilities, including HAM, SAM, EA, GRC, and future capabilities such as AI Control Tower, ensuring the ongoing maintenance, enhancement, and maturation of these solutions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Mentor ServiceNow developers, ensuring best practices in coding, configuration, and integration.
  • Define and execute the ServiceNow development roadmap, aligning with organizational goals.
  • Collaborate with IT leadership and stakeholders to drive platform adoption and innovation.
  • Establish governance frameworks, coding standards, and security protocols for ServiceNow development.
  • Responsible for - design, development, and deployment of ServiceNow applications, service catalog items, workflows, and integrations along with effort & schedule estimates.
  • Provide technical solutions, design and development guidance to the engineering team for HAM, SAM, EA, GRC, and future capabilities such as AI Control Tower
  • Lead complex integrations with third-party applications using REST, SOAP, LDAP, MID Server, and APIs.
  • Implement automation, AI/ML-driven workflows, and ServiceNow best practices to enhance business processes.
  • Ensure compliance with ITIL frameworks, security policies, and ServiceNow standards.
  • Support the Operations /SRE team to manage system upgrades, patching, and overall platform stability.
  • Work closely with business units, IT teams, and ServiceNow administrators to gather requirements and translate them into solutions.
  • Support the Transformation lead for continuous service improvement and Ops Lead for the platform management activities i.e. EOL upgrades and Family updates. 

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• -Strong expertise in JavaScript, Glide API, AngularJS, HTML, CSS, and ServiceNow development frameworks.
  • -Deep knowledge of ITSM, ITOM, CMDB, HRSD, SecOps, CSM, and custom application development on ServiceNow.
  • -Proven experience in HAM OR SAM.
  • -Experience in CI/CD, DevOps methodologies, and Agile/Scrum development.

Certifications

  • - ServiceNow Certified System Administrator (CSA),
  • - Certified Application Developer (CAD),
  • - Certified Implementation Specialist (CIS) is preferred.

Experience Required:  

  • - Bachelor's or master's degree in IT or Computer Science.
  • - 7 to 10 years of experience in ServiceNow development and leadership roles.
